Nancy Cunningham was born in Huntingdon County, Pennsylvania and died on Jan 14, 1881 in Ross County, Ohio at 82. She married James Elder Kerr, Sr. on Aug 6, 1816 in Ross County, Ohio. During their forty years of married life they were members of the Greenfield Presbyterian Church, and after his death, she was a member of the Pisgah Church in Ohio. They had 13 children.
